Simply put, the dental clinic micromotor uses the characteristics of piezoelectric material to produce deformation when input voltage, so that it can generate mechanical vibration of ultrasonic frequency, and then through the design of friction drive mechanism, the ultrasonic motor can be used as an electromagnetic motor. Rotational movement or linear movement.

Normally, when the electromagnetic motor is running, we will feel that there is noise. This is because the internal structure of the motor produces vibration, and the vibration frequency is just within the frequency range that our ears can feel.
